Pocket door repair services address issues related to sliding doors that are installed within a wall cavity. These services typically involve diagnosing problems such as doors that do not slide smoothly, become stuck, or fall off their tracks. Repair professionals may adjust or replace door rollers, realign the track system, or fix damaged hardware to restore proper operation. In some cases, repairs also include fixing or replacing the door itself if it has become warped, cracked, or otherwise compromised.
Many common problems that lead property owners to seek pocket door repair include misalignment, difficulty opening or closing, and noise during operation. Over time, hardware components like rollers and tracks can wear out or become damaged, resulting in the door dragging or sticking. Additionally, issues such as loose or broken hardware, warped framing, or obstructions within the track can prevent the door from functioning correctly. Repair services aim to resolve these issues efficiently, often restoring the door to its original smooth operation.

Average Cost - The typical cost for pocket door repair ranges from $150 to $500, depending on the extent of the damage and parts needed. For example, replacing a track might cost around $200, while repairing a damaged frame could be closer to $400.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for pocket door repairs usually fall between $75 and $150 per hour. The total labor cost depends on the complexity of the repair and the number of doors involved.
Parts and Materials - Replacement parts such as rollers, tracks, or handles generally cost between $20 and $100 each. Higher-end hardware or custom components may increase the overall expense.
Cost Factors - The overall cost varies based on the door type, damage severity, and accessibility. Complex repairs or additional work like frame reinforcement can raise the price beyond typical ranges.
